No-gi submission grappling is a dynamic form of competitive grappling that stands apart from traditional martial arts due to its focus on techniques and submissions without the use of the traditional uniform (gi).

This style prioritizes agility, speed, and technique to control and defeat opponents, aiming to secure submissions through joint locks and chokeholds, resulting in tap-outs or verbal concessions. Unlike gi grappling, where clothing grips play a significant role, no-gi grappling emphasizes body positioning, leverage, and skillful execution.

Speed and Agility:

No-gi grappling offers a faster-paced, dynamic experience by eliminating gi-related grips and slowing factors typical in traditional gi grappling.

Realistic Self-Defense:

The practicality of no-gi techniques makes them highly applicable to real-world self-defense situations, where opponents might not be wearing gis.

Physical Conditioning:

Engaging in no-gi grappling enhances cardiovascular endurance, muscular strength, and overall physical fitness due to its demanding nature.

Technique Mastery:

The absence of gi grips necessitates a deeper understanding of body mechanics, leverage, and precise positioning, fostering mastery of fundamental grappling techniques.

Versatility for Sports:

Proficiency in both gi and no-gi grappling is valuable across various combat sports and martial arts, making practitioners versatile athletes.

Innovation and Creativity:

No-gi grappling encourages innovative approaches to control and submission, spurring creativity among practitioners in transitions and strategies.

Competitive Opportunities:

Thriving as a competitive sport, no-gi submission grappling boasts numerous tournaments and organizations, providing platforms for skill assessment.

No-gi submission grappling offers a dynamic and practical dimension to grappling techniques. Complementing traditional gi grappling, it equips practitioners with a well-rounded skill set applicable in self-defense and competitive scenarios.
